Author: Jules Ph.D. July 12, 2021 Duration: 50:10
In this episode I talk to Statement Analysis Mark McClish about Darlie's 911 call and interviews. Mark talks about the many, many issues in Darlie's statements and why he believes that she is where she is supposed to, behind bars. Listen and see if you agree.
